Output ded90eaf4a611fa054b1f4d9ac2e29ac3b417fa543a8683ee501229187bf620b:2

value
102796401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a99c4f596db40b85d7ee808e27864d66cf16d0e0 OP_EQUAL
address
3H9qNZyi4LNjcFejQzjp3vR9dMqanJ4hZY
transaction
ded90eaf4a611fa054b1f4d9ac2e29ac3b417fa543a8683ee501229187bf620b
spent
true